Abstract

This study aims to produce an audio visual media on volleyball forearm pass technique for senior high school students. The method used is Research and Development (R&D) which is using Dick and Carey development design. It was adapted to this research become four stages, namely (1) needs analysis stage was conducted by literature study, that was by conducting field study or observation; (2) design product stage which was divided into three sections including: preparation of volly forearm pass technique materials, setting up storyboards, video capture and video editing; (3) product evaluation stage, the product will be evaluated by a learning design expert, physical education specialist, and software specialist (4) and final product steps form a feasible audio visual media on volleyball forearm pass technique for senior high school students.
